And now, for a "Reason Why I Love The Phantom Menace."



For me, this scene with Amidala looking out of the window perfectly expresses the sadness that Leia describes knowing of her mother in ROTJ. Knowing how young Queen Amidala is and the problems she's wrestling with in her mind, I love Natalie Portman's performance in this scene; I think she captures the character exceptionally well.

And then, bring in Jar Jar Binks. Most of the movie, Jar Jar spends playing the clown; he bumbles about providing a multitude of laughs. But in this scene, he shows greater depth to his character when he comes up beside Amidala and looks out the window with her. The two of them -- she: the highest positioned person in her society; he: exiled from his people -- come together here in this scene. There had been connections made earlier in the movie, but it is in this scene that the two characters make a major connection. With one of the main themes of The Phantom Menace being symbiosis, this scene further develops and explores that theme. It is here that Binks, rather subconsciously, and Amidala, through listening to Binks talk, state that their two peoples are connected. And in that instant, Amidala begins to see the plan that will save not her planet but their planet.

This is definitely one of my favorite scenes in The Phantom Menace.
